navigationandroid-jetpack-composepager

How can I use with jetpack HorizontalPager with HorizontalPagerIndicator on NavHost controller


I have nine screens and I want use NavHost with HorizontalPagerIndicator.


Solution

  • Use HorizontalPager

     val pagerState = rememberPagerState(pageCount = {
      10
     })
    
     HorizontalPager(state = pagerState) { page ->
     // Our page content
     Text(
        text = "Page: $page",
        modifier = Modifier.fillMaxWidth()
    )
    }
    

    for more details refer Pager in compose